Registering your trip with the Netherlands embassy is essential for ensuring your safety while traveling abroad. By providing the embassy with your travel details, you enable them to offer vital support in emergencies. For instance, during natural disasters, such as earthquakes or floods, the registration allows authorities to locate and assist you quickly. In cases of political unrest, the embassy can keep you informed about safety measures and potential evacuation processes. Additionally, if you face medical emergencies, the embassy can facilitate access to appropriate healthcare and support services. Overall, trip registration enhances communication and creates a direct lifeline between you and your country, significantly increasing your peace of mind while traveling.
Can the Netherlands embassy assist in legal issues abroad?
Yes, the Netherlands embassy can provide assistance in legal matters by directing you to local legal resources and offering guidance on navigating the legal system in the United Arab Emirates.
What should I do if I lose my Netherlands passport in United Arab Emirates?
If you lose your passport, promptly report the loss to local authorities and visit the Netherlands embassy. They will guide you through the process of obtaining a replacement passport.
Do I need to make an appointment to visit the embassy?
Yes, it is advisable to make an appointment for most services to ensure that staff can assist you effectively.
Can the embassy help me find an interpreter during my stay?
While the embassy may not provide interpreters directly, they can recommend local resources where you can find one.
What support is available for students studying in the UAE?
The embassy offers support for students, including guidance on legal issues, educational opportunities, and safety information while studying in the UAE.
The Netherlands maintains a significant diplomatic presence in the United Arab Emirates through its embassy located in Abu Dhabi and a consulate in Dubai. The embassy is primarily responsible for fostering bilateral relations, offering consular assistance, and promoting Dutch interests in trade, culture, and international cooperation. Through these diplomatic missions, the Netherlands aims to enhance political dialogue and strengthen economic ties with the Emirates. The presence of the embassy and consulate plays a vital role in facilitating communication and protecting the interests of Dutch nationals in the UAE, showcasing the importance of their bilateral relationship.
